The best suppliers make safety part of buying
Chemicals are not normal retail goods. Even common industrial chemicals may need careful storage, protective gear, ventilation, and safe transport. A professional supplier should treat safety as part of the sale.
Before you buy, ask whether the product has proper labels and, where needed, safety notes. For businesses, this matters even more. Poor handling can damage stock, create workplace risk, slow production, or lead to compliance problems. A reliable supplier will be ready to talk about handling steps, not just quick sales.
Use this quick checklist before you order:
- Confirm the exact chemical name and strength.
- Ask whether the product is industrial, food, cosmetic, pharma, laboratory, or technical grade.
- Check the pack size, seal, and labels.
- Ask about storage notes and shelf life if needed.
- Confirm whether protective handling is needed.
- Ask for papers when your work needs them.
- Avoid damaged, leaking, unlabeled, or repacked containers with no clear source.
This list is simple, but it can prevent many buying mistakes. It also helps you compare different chemical dealers in Pakistan in a fairer way, because you are not judging by price alone.

How do I compare chemical suppliers in Pakistan?
Compare chemical suppliers in Pakistan by looking at quality, consistency, documents, pricing, and delivery reliability. The lowest price is not always the best deal if the product is inconsistent, poorly labeled, late, or wrong for your use. A professional supplier should help you buy the right material, not just the cheapest one.
When you compare suppliers, think about risk and reliability. For example, a manufacturer may lose far more money from a late delivery than from paying a bit more to a dependable chemical wholesaler. A retailer also needs the same pack and quality each time so customers get the same result.
A practical comparison process looks like this:
- Shortlist suppliers by place and product range. Start with nearby options, then widen the search if needed.
- Ask for exact details. Do not rely on general names. Confirm grade, purity, strength, and use.
- Check packaging options. Small bottles, drums, bags, and bulk containers fit different needs.
- Review communication quality. Clear, patient answers often show a more professional business.
- Confirm delivery and payment terms. Delays and unclear terms can cause problems for businesses.
- Test before you scale up. For production or resale, order a small amount first if you can.
This process works whether you are buying from local chemical shops, national distributors, or an online chemical store in Pakistan.
Different buyers need different suppliers
Not every buyer needs the same type of supplier. A cleaning business, textile unit, laboratory, water treatment company, and cosmetics startup may all search for chemical suppliers in Pakistan, but their needs can be very different.
A business buying for manufacturing may care most about consistency, bulk pricing, and steady supply. A lab or school buyer may need smaller amounts, clearer labels, and special grades. A reseller may care most about packaging, stock, and supplier trust. A maintenance team may want fast delivery and practical help.
Here are common supplier types and when they may fit:
- Retail chemical shops: Good for small amounts, urgent needs, and direct buying.
- Wholesale suppliers: Better for bulk orders, repeat buying, and business supply.
- Importers: Useful when you need imported grades, branded chemicals, or items not easy to find locally.
- Online suppliers: Handy for checking product lists, asking for quotes, and ordering from another city.
- Industry-focused distributors: Helpful when you need chemicals for a set sector, such as textiles, cleaning, water treatment, paints, agriculture, or personal care.
If you search for chemical industries near me, you may also find makers, processors, or industrial zones instead of retail shops. That can help with business networking, but it may not lead to a direct purchase. Be clear about whether you need a shop, wholesaler, importer, distributor, or maker.

Price matters, but consistency matters more
Many buyers focus on price first, especially when buying in bulk. Price matters, but it should be weighed against quality, packaging, delivery time, and supplier trust. A cheaper chemical that works badly, arrives late, or changes from batch to batch can cost more later.
For business use, consistency is often the real value. If a detergent maker, textile processor, or water treatment service depends on one chemical input, sudden changes in quality can change the end result. A good supplier understands this and aims to provide stable products, not random stock from unclear sources.
When you talk about price, ask these questions:
- Is the quoted rate for the same grade and strength?
- Does the price include packaging or delivery?
- Are bulk rates available for repeat orders?
- Can the supplier keep regular stock?
- What happens if the delivered product is damaged or wrong?
These questions make price comparisons more useful. They also help separate serious suppliers from sellers who only compete on the lowest number.
Building a reliable supplier relationship
Once you find a trustworthy supplier, treat that relationship as a business asset. Good suppliers can tell you when stock is low, suggest suitable options when needed, and help plan repeat buying. This is especially helpful for companies that depend on chemicals in Pakistan for regular work.
Keep records of what you buy, including product name, grade, quantity, supplier details, batch data if available, and purchase date. These records make repeat ordering easier and help fix problems if a product does not work as expected. If your business grows, clear buying records also make it easier to work with a chemical wholesaler or compare more chemical suppliers in Pakistan.
A strong supplier relationship is built on clear communication. Tell the supplier how you plan to use the product, how much you need, and whether you need the same spec every time. The more exact you are, the easier it is for the supplier to suggest the right option.
